Choosing Reporting Tools that Align with Your Business Goals

In today’s data-driven landscape, selecting the right reporting tools is crucial for business success. Businesses must focus on their specific objectives before making a choice. A well-aligned reporting tool ensures that data visualization is intuitive and actionable. Begin by identifying the key performance indicators (KPIs) that your business relies on. KPIs serve as essential metrics that evaluate success. Choose tools that easily integrate with existing data sources, like CRMs and ERPs. A seamless data integration will save valuable time and reduce errors. Look for features that enable customization, allowing you to tailor the reports to different audiences. Apart from customization, ensure that the tool offers robust data security measures. Data breaches can severely harm your business reputation. Furthermore, consider the scalability of the reporting tool. A good tool should grow along with your organization and adapt to changing needs. Training and support should also be available to ensure efficient use. When choosing reporting tools, understanding these factors will lead to a selection that aligns with your business goals.

Understanding the specific features of reporting tools can greatly enhance your decision-making process. Focus on data visualization options, as effective visualization aids in comprehending complex information. Tools that offer a variety of chart types, graphs, and dashboards are preferable. This variety allows teams to pick the best way to represent data, making insights more accessible. Features such as drag-and-drop functionality can streamline the reporting process, minimizing the time spent on formatting. Additionally, explore the extent to which the tools support data manipulation. The ability to filter, sort, and analyze data directly within the reporting tool adds value to your analysis. Having access to historical data can also provide context and depth to current reports, benefiting decision-making processes. Interactivity is another essential feature; consider tools that allow users to drill down into data for deeper insights. Finally, examine whether the tools allow for automated report generation, saving time and ensuring consistency in reporting. These features significantly improve user experience and satisfaction, ultimately leading to better outcomes for your business.

Cost Considerations When Selecting Reporting Tools

Cost is a major factor when choosing reporting tools that fit within your budget. Different tools come with varying pricing models, including subscription-based and one-time purchase options. It’s essential to carefully evaluate these models to identify what aligns best with your financial strategy. Additionally, consider the hidden costs associated with implementation, maintenance, and training. Ensure that your choice won’t lead to unforeseen expenses that could strain your budget. Be wary of tools that seem inexpensive at first glance; they might lack necessary features or support. It’s prudent to consider the total cost of ownership instead of looking solely at upfront costs. Factor in potential upgrades and expansions that might be required as your business evolves. Analysing several tools through demos or trial versions can help assess their value against their cost. Most tools offer free trials to allow you to evaluate their fit without financial commitment. This approach can help you make an informed decision based on demonstrated functionality and usability rather than assumptions.

The role of customer support is vital when utilizing reporting tools. A reliable support team can drastically influence your experience with the tool. Whenever technical issues arise, responsive customer service can minimize downtime and enhance productivity. Look for tools that offer multiple support channels, such as live chat, email, and tutorials. Having access to a knowledge base aids in self-resolution of common queries. Furthermore, consider the availability of community forums or user groups, as connecting with other users can lead to shared experiences and solutions. User feedback can provide insights tailored to industry-specific needs. Training offered by vendors can significantly improve efficiency, as staff members become proficient in using the tools. Check the frequency of updates and feature additions, as consistent improvements can enhance the longevity of the tool’s relevance. Engagement with the vendor can also be beneficial in ensuring that the tool continues to meet changing business requirements. Ultimately, choosing a tool backed by solid customer support will empower your team to leverage data effectively.
